OpenVAS Features

  • icon_check Vulnerability Scanning
    Performs deep network and host vulnerability scans using extensive checks to detect security weaknesses across diverse systems.
  • icon_check Authenticated Scanning
    Supports credential-based scanning to analyze internal configurations and detect vulnerabilities hidden from external probes.
  • icon_check Unauthenticated Scanning
    Runs external-style scans without login credentials to identify exposed services and weak points visible to outside attackers.
  • icon_check Comprehensive Protocol Support
    Scans networks using numerous protocols including HTTP, SSH, SMB, FTP, SNMP, and industrial systems for broad coverage.
  • icon_check Custom Scan Configurations
    Allows tailored scan policies enabling control over test intensity, ports, scanning depth, and performance preferences.
  • icon_check Large-Scale Scan Performance
    Optimized for high-volume enterprise scans, balancing speed and accuracy across thousands of assets without performance loss.
  • icon_check CVSS-Based Scoring
    Uses CVSS scoring to quantify vulnerability severity, helping teams prioritize remediation based on standardized risk levels.
  • icon_check Reporting
    Generates comprehensive HTML, PDF, and XML vulnerability reports with severity breakdowns and actionable remediation guidance.
  • icon_check Asset Discovery
    Automatically identifies active hosts, open services, operating systems, and network characteristics for full asset visibility.
  • icon_check Task Automation
    Enables automated recurring scans, report generation, and alerts to maintain continuous vulnerability monitoring.
  • icon_check Plugin-Based Architecture
    Uses thousands of modular vulnerability tests allowing rapid updates, targeted checks, and expansion without system rebuilds.
  • icon_check Advanced Filtering & Analysis
    Offers powerful filtering, sorting, and analytics options within scan results to quickly isolate critical vulnerabilities.
  • icon_check Credential Management
    Securely stores and manages host credentials to streamline authenticated scans across servers, devices, and network systems.
  • icon_check Detection of Misconfigurations
    Identifies insecure configurations, weak encryption, outdated software, and policy violations that reduce overall security

Which operating system does OpenVAS support?

OpenVAS is compatible with Linux-based systems and can also be deployed on Windows and macOS via virtual machines or Docker containers.

How does OpenVAS work?

OpenVAS scans networks, servers, and applications using a regularly updated database of vulnerability tests, identifying weaknesses and generating reports with recommended fixes.
